import { observable, type Observable } from "@legendapp/state"; import { onUnmount, type DeepMaybeObservable, type ReadonlyObservable } from "@usels/core"; import { resolveWindowSource, type ConfigurableWindow } from "@shared/configurable"; import { createEventListener } from "../../browser/useEventListener/core"; export interface UseMagicKeysOptions extends ConfigurableWindow { /** Custom alias map for key names */ aliasMap?: Record; /** Event handler called on every keydown/keyup. Return false to skip tracking. */ onEventFired?: (e: KeyboardEvent) => boolean | void; /** Options passed to the underlying addEventListener calls. @default { passive: true } */ eventListenerOptions?: AddEventListenerOptions; } const DEFAULT_ALIAS_MAP: Record = { ctrl: "control", cmd: "meta", command: "meta", option: "alt", esc: "escape", del: "delete", space: " ", up: "arrowup", down: "arrowdown", left: "arrowleft", right: "arrowright", }; export type UseMagicKeysReturn = { /** Set of currently pressed key names (lowercase) */ current$: ReadonlyObservable>; } & { /** Access any key as a reactive boolean. e.g., keys["a"], keys["shift"], keys["ctrl+a"] */ [key: string]: ReadonlyObservable; }; /** * Framework-agnostic magic keys tracker. * * Tracks keyboard state via `keydown`/`keyup`/`blur` events on window. * Returns a Proxy that exposes any key as a reactive boolean observable, * and supports combo keys (e.g. `ctrl+a`). */ /*@__NO_SIDE_EFFECTS__*/ export function createMagicKeys( options?: DeepMaybeObservable ): UseMagicKeysReturn { const opts$ = observable(options); const win$ = resolveWindowSource(opts$.window as unknown as Observable); // Mount-time reads const aliasMap = opts$.peek()?.aliasMap ?? {}; const eventListenerOptions = (opts$.peek()?.eventListenerOptions ?? { passive: true, }) as AddEventListenerOptions; const mergedAliases: Record = { ...DEFAULT_ALIAS_MAP, ...aliasMap }; const keyMap = new Map>(); const comboKeys = new Set(); const pressedKeys = new Set(); const current$ = observable>(new Set()); const resolveKey = (key: string): string => { const lower = key.toLowerCase(); return mergedAliases[lower] ?? lower; }; const getOrCreateKey = (key: string): Observable => { const resolved = resolveKey(key); let obs = keyMap.get(resolved); if (!obs) { obs = observable(false); keyMap.set(resolved, obs); } return obs; }; const isComboPressed = (combo: string): boolean => { return combo .split("+") .map((p) => resolveKey(p.trim())) .every((k) => pressedKeys.has(k)); }; const updateCombos = () => { for (const combo of comboKeys) { const key = `__combo__${combo}`; const obs = keyMap.get(key); if (obs) obs.set(isComboPressed(combo)); } }; const proxy = new Proxy({} as UseMagicKeysReturn, { get(_target, prop: string) { if (prop === "current$") return current$; // Strip trailing $ and convert _ to + for destructuring support let key = prop; if (key.endsWith("$")) key = key.slice(0, -1); key = key.replace(/_/g, "+"); if (key.includes("+")) { comboKeys.add(key); const comboKey = `__combo__${key}`; let obs = keyMap.get(comboKey); if (!obs) { obs = observable(false); keyMap.set(comboKey, obs); } return obs; } return getOrCreateKey(key); }, }); const onKeyDown = (e: KeyboardEvent) => { const onEventFired = opts$.peek()?.onEventFired as | ((e: KeyboardEvent) => boolean | void) | undefined; if (onEventFired?.(e) === false) return; const key = resolveKey(e.key); pressedKeys.add(key); getOrCreateKey(e.key).set(true); current$.set(new Set(pressedKeys)); updateCombos(); }; const onKeyUp = (e: KeyboardEvent) => { const onEventFired = opts$.peek()?.onEventFired as | ((e: KeyboardEvent) => boolean | void) | undefined; if (onEventFired?.(e) === false) return; const key = resolveKey(e.key); // macOS: when Meta is released, other keys don't receive keyup events. // Clear everything to avoid stuck keys. if (key === "meta") { pressedKeys.clear(); for (const [, obs] of keyMap) { obs.set(false); } current$.set(new Set()); updateCombos(); return; } pressedKeys.delete(key); getOrCreateKey(e.key).set(false); current$.set(new Set(pressedKeys)); updateCombos(); }; const onBlur = () => { pressedKeys.clear(); for (const [, obs] of keyMap) { obs.set(false); } current$.set(new Set()); }; createEventListener(win$, "keydown", onKeyDown, eventListenerOptions); createEventListener(win$, "keyup", onKeyUp, eventListenerOptions); createEventListener(win$, "blur", onBlur, eventListenerOptions); onUnmount(() => { pressedKeys.clear(); keyMap.clear(); comboKeys.clear(); }); return proxy; }
